I just finished watching ‘The Intern’ on OTT today, and wow, what a genuinely good time it gave me! I absolutely love films that manage to blend substance with lightheartedness, and this one hit all the right notes. It’s truly fun and mature at the same time, a rare and delightful combination.

The premise itself hooked me: an old man, 70 years young, with such an incredible will to live with enthusiasm and to keep doing something even after retirement. It’s inspiring! His workaholic nature, coupled with that understandable lonely feeling after losing his wife, drives this senior citizen to take on an intern’s job at a modern, internet-driven company run by young people with their very contemporary approaches and thinking. You can clearly see how the vigor of youth drives things fast, but the touch of maturity always acts like a vital backbone, and this story illustrates that beautifully.

And then there’s Robert De Niro. He’s not a person who needs an introduction; his acting has always been phenomenal, and here in this film, his very presence creates such an impact.

Robert De Niro’s performance in “The Intern” is a charming and gentle reminder that wisdom and experience are not a burden, but a resource. The film wisely avoids the slapstick of a fish-out-of-water story, instead finding its humor and heart in the subtle clash of generations. It’s a feel-good film that doesn’t feel manufactured, but rather earned through its genuine respect for both its characters. The movie’s greatest strength is its wit, which is as understated as its humor and as sharp as its observations about the modern workplace. It’s a delightful, brief escape that leaves you with a warm feeling and the quiet knowledge that sometimes, the best mentorship comes from the most unexpected places.

Watching the intern gradually become a mentor, both professionally and even more so in personal life, is an amazing role reversal to witness. The dynamic presence of both generations in this film is definitely something that attracts a large audience, and it’s clear it has already done so since its release.

I give this film my full recommendations!
